Paweł Patrzyk is a Wire Sculptor and Structure Researcher specializing in complex spatial wire forms and hand-constructed steel structures.Paweł Patrzyk (b. 1985, Częstochowa, Poland) is a sculptor whose artistic practice forms a unique bridge between visual arts and neuroscience. Rather than merely replicating reality, his work analyzes the biological and emotional mechanisms of human functioning, most notably explored the "Antifragility" series (Antykruchość).
Patrzyk’s signature style is characterized by intricate, openwork structures constructed from hundreds of meters of wire. Created entirely freehand without the use of ready-made templates or molds, these forms demonstrate exceptional technical precision.
His work has gained international recognition, with a career breakthrough marked by the "Legami" exhibition at the Arcadia Art Gallery in Milan (2023) and winning the Grand Prize in the prestigious Boynes Monthly Art Award. His sculptures have also been distinguished by the international Camelback Gallery platform.
